Move-In Information

PHINS are allowed to move into their College Houses on Saturday, August 15, any time after 2pm EST.  

You may have received an email from Penn Residential Services about selecting your move-in time. Please disregard that email as our office will be sponsoring your early move-in. You do NOT need to take any action at this time.

If you are living in Greek Housing, please be advised to contact the Office of Fraternity & Sorority Life (OFSL) and/or your individual organization separately. We only sponsor early move-in for College House residents.

PHINS Training

Group of PHINS smiling for a picture, holding a dog.

The MANDATORY In-Person PHINS Training will be held on Sunday, August 16 from 10am to 3pm in Meyerson Hall B-1.

Your attendance is crucial as we will be discussing schedules, responsibilities, and sharing advice on how to make the most out of your PHINS experience!

The Transfer Student Organization (TSO) Board will play a large part here in leading tPHINS through transfer-specific training.

In early August, all tPHINS will receive an invitation to PHINS CORE, an asynchronous Canvas course. You are required to complete the course by Saturday, August 15, prior to the in-person training.

Last but not least, all PHINS will receive FREE MERCH! At the end of the training, we will distribute PHINS merchandise and take a team photo. You definitely don’t want to miss this!
